SkinMedica, XIFIN finish near top in Technology Fast 50
By: BRADLEY J. FIKES - Staff Writer
Carlsbad's SkinMedica and Carmel Valley-based XIFIN led the list of North County companies recognized
as the 50 fastest-growing in San Diego County. The San Diego Technology Fast 50 awards event honoring these
companies was held Thursday.
SkinMedica, XIFIN and 14 other North County companies made the 2005 list of fastest-growing companies.
The companies were ranked by percentage revenue growth from 2000-04. SkinMedica ranked third with revenue
growth of 4,467 percent. XIFIN ranked fifth with 3,414 percent revenue growth. Active Motif of Carlsbad
finished sixth, with 2,789 percent growth.
San Diego-based NuVasive ranked first, with 73,752 percent revenue growth. Another San Diego-based company,
BakBone Software, placed second, with growth of 7,944 percent.
Other North County companies in the list include: Digirad Corp., e.Digital Corp., Neurocrine Biosciences,
Invitrogen Corp., American Technologies, Viasat Inc., St. Bernard Software, ResMed Corp., Dot Hill Systems, dj
Orthopedics, SeraCare Life Sciences Inc., Natural Alternatives International, and NTN Communications Inc.
To be considered, participants must have operating revenues of at least $50,000 in 2000 and at least $1 million
in 2004, be headquartered in San Diego County, and be a technology company (including life sciences).
The list is presented by Deloitte & Touche LLP, Brown Thompson Executive Search and Comerica. Other presenters
are Cooley Godward LLP, Corporate Real Estate Advisors, Focus Creative, KPBS, Marsh, and Shoreline Press. The
American Electronics Association and Biocom also took part.
